71,315 Shares in SolarEdge Technologies, Inc. (NASDAQ:SEDG) Purchased by Global Assets Advisory LLC

Global Assets Advisory LLC purchased a new stake in SolarEdge Technologies, Inc. (NASDAQ:SEDGFree Report) during the first qu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und purchased 71,315 shares of the semiconductor company’s stock, valued at approximately $5,062,000. Global Assets Advisory LLC owned approximately 0.12% of SolarEdge Technologies as of its most recent SEC filing.

SolarEdge Technologies Company Profile

(Free Report)

SolarEdge Technologies,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, designs, develops, manufactures, and sells direct current (DC) optimized inverter systems for solar photovoltaic (PV) installations in the United States, Germany, the Netherlands, Italy, rest of Europe, and internationally. It operates in two segments, Solar and Energy Storage.
